    First off, there's no way Tebow was staying in Denver - Elway, rightly, didn't rate him. Secondly, the Jets' issues this year run much deeper than the quarterback position. I still rate Sanchez and I feel under the right circumstances he can be a successful QB for us in the future. You don't take your team to two AFC championship games and 4 road playoff victories if you're one of the leagues poorest quarterbacks. Unfortunately his play and his confidence has been absolutely shot to bits by injuries to key players like Holmes and Keller, the ridiculous offensive packages that Sporano has brought in and this notion that Tebow should be on the field every few snaps too. The whole Tebow mess has been predictable and its obvious that he's only here under the whim of Woody Johnson.

    Tebow is clearly not good enough - I will grant him the fact he did well in Denver briefly but a few good games doesnt make a Quarterback (look at Matt Cassel!) He had Kyle Orton ranked ahead of him in Denver!

    He needs a lot of work but he isnt anywhere he can develop and also the media wont let him develop! This "Tebow-mania" is a big problem, every day I watch sports center and they will have some debate on Tebow as if the Jets are keeping a Peyton, Brady or Eli on the bench rather than a guy who threw for 22 yards!

    He should move to Jacksonville and let the organisation build around him. I have to admit, the man is taking it all very well and appearing to just get on with work - I probably wouldnt be all smiles and be nice if I were in his shoes.
